Job Description
Duties and Responsibilities
- Design, develop, and implement software applications according to business requirements
- Maintain and improve existing applications by debugging, refactoring, and optimizing performance
- Write clean, efficient, and well-documented code following best practices
- Collaborate with business analysts and stakeholders to understand user needs and translate them into technical specifications
- Design application architecture, database structures, and system integration strategies
- Ensure software solutions are scalable, maintainable, and secure
- Develop and execute test cases to ensure application functionality and reliability
- Conduct unit testing, integration testing, and system testing
- Work with QA teams to resolve defects and improve software quality
- Prepare and deploy applications to production environments following deployment protocols
- Provide technical support a...
Ready to Apply?
Take the next step in your AI career. Submit your application to Asian Technology Solutions today.
Submit Application